Spotlight on Alisha Larry
This dynamic performer is a standout artist in electronic dance music. Known for her captivating vocals, she combines elements of dance, pop, and electronic styles into commercially appealing yet artistic songs.
Her career has been marked by consistent growth, with her performances featured in major festivals worldwide. Can’t Get You Out of My Head shows why she is a must-watch artist for club audiences.
